Here are the E-mini S&P 500 futures contract specifications. E-mini S&P 500 futures contract specifications. 0.25, worth $12.50 per contract. E-mini S&P 500 futures trade on the CME Globex ® trading platform, from 6:00 p.m. U.S. ET all the way until 5:00 p.m. U.S. ET the following afternoon. Instead of 9:30 a.m. to 4 p.m. ET, the futures market is open nearly 24 hours a day, six days a week. Therefore, single-stock futures could be traded out of either securities or a futures account. SSFs in the U.S. Initially, two exchanges offered security futures products, including single stock futures. To start with, in 2000, Nasdaq-LIFFE Markets (NQLX) became the first U.S. exchange established to trade single stock futures but had to …After Hours Market: Futures markets trade at many different times of the day. In addition, futures markets can indicate how underlying markets may open. For example, stock index futures will likely tell traders whether the stock market may open up or down.

Dec 18, 2021 · Stock futures are another derivative product, like options, that allow you to make complex trades on stock indexes. Unlike options, they trade nearly 24 hours per day, from Sunday evening through Friday afternoon. The futures market opens Sunday at 6 p.m. EST.
